I’m so sorry for your anger, I get it. I live a few blocks south of NY Drive, North of Washington, between Lake and Hill. Went above NY Drive up Holliston below Mendocino first in my neighbors truck then via my Vespa of all things. Then checked on friends on the East side of the golf course. Total chaos, no wind but the homes on that side are close to each other so they would eventually catch. When the water ran out the few FD in the area bailed and left resident and people who were able to get up to bucket water from pools to finish putting out the house fires next to their intact homes. Would dart up to help then race back to check on my house and block for spot fires and looters which there were so many of. This was on Weds. Thursday am went up NY Drive but it was blocked until just passed Allen so I went up past Prime Pizza to check on friends homes. Went all the way up stopping to check addresses for friends, stomping on bushes with my Chuck Taylor’s where I could and seemed helpful to a structure, saw a beautiful artist friend whose house made it in Homewood and we cried, he stayed behind and saved his home and his neighbors to the left a right. I kept going and more of the same. Sat in the Aldis parking lot, talked with a photog from Pasadena Now, cried some more. I knew when I left down Lake past Woodbury I would have a hard time getting back up because more services were arriving and would start blocking more off but I had to check on my home, my block, my neighbors properties who had left.
